Extension Visa Approved in 2 Months without Interview

Post by amiao6 » Mon Feb 27, 2017 11:16 pm

Dear all,

Thank you very much for the help and advice I received through this extension process. Now I received my approval decision, so I want to share my timeline and experience to help more people.

Timeline:

22th December 2016- Application sent.
06th January 2017- Biometric Enrolment Invitation received.
10th January 2017- Biometric enrolled.
24th February 2017- Approval Confirmation received.
27th February 2017- BRP card received.

One week after biometric enrolment, my partner and I got a letter from Home Office basically saying that our case is extremely complicated and they won't be able to make decision within 8 weeks time. I was panic for a while until read some threads talking about this kind of letter. If you received this letter, it's probably because Home Office wants you to know "We are quite busy at the moment, please do not call or write to us if we can't give you a result after 8 weeks". Overall I am quite happy with this timeline considering we had Christmas and New Year holiday from the end of December.

Please feel free to ask any question. I will answer it with my best knowledge (But sorry maybe not very prompt because I am on holiday :) ). Wish you all have a good result if you are still in the application process.
